WASHINGTON, Oct. 11 -- The American Immigration Lawyers Association issued the following statement by Executive Director Benjamin Johnson:
Today, the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A) welcomed the ruling of the U.S. District Court of the Southern District of New York in the Make the Road litigation which enjoins the administration from implementing the Public Charge Final Rule and specifically restrains the government from implementing or requiring the use of any new . . .
